Abstract (EN)
Motor drives play an important role in power electronics applications. Nowadays, when electric vehicles become widespread (such as automobiles and motorcycles), the speed of the engines used in these vehicles should be controlled accurately. Furthermore, with this control, the energy stored in the batteries should be used with the highest efficiency. Although different motors are used in vehicles running with electric motors, Brushless DC Motors (BLDC) are used mostly in English. In these motors, either solvent, encoder or Hall sensors called sincos are used for position data. The position information of the windings is an important factor for controlling the motor. After the position data is obtained, the necessary switching elements are controlled by the controller and the motor windings are energized. In this way, the movement of the motor is provided as a result of the pushing and pulling force formed between the magnets and the windings.
